#0b6be5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b6be5 is composed of 4.3% red, 42%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 53.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 213.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#0b6be5 color hex could be obtained by blending #16d6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

● #0b6be5 color description : Vivid blue.
#0b6be5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b6be5 has RGB values of R:11, G:107,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 748517.

Shades and Tints of #0b6be5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f1f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0b6be5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71777f is the less saturated color, while #026aee is the most saturated one.
